From Bjorn Freeman-Benson on 11-Oct-2009
Friendly and helpful service, in spite of our being a tiny Cessna rather than a big money business jet. Rented a car, parked for the weekend, all prompt and reasonably priced.
 
From Stuart Todd Mollerup on 07-Oct-2009
I really appreciated the front desk's help making very affordable hotel reservations at the Hilton and providing transportation to and from. Wonderful. The ramp, however, is crazy busy and crowded. I had my AI in my Piper Warrior II fail while inbound, and the attached instrument shop replace it in the morning for a very reasonable fee. Painless!! I also love that there is Windsock Pilot Shop across the street.
 
From Noah Fong on 16-Sep-2009
I give Atlantic a thumbs up. I had used them several years ago and it was a pleasant experience but I wanted to know if they changed. We were there yesterday and it continued to be a great experience. First, I had parked at the wrong place (a neighboring business) and they towed it to their parking for me. Then, they helped me unload luggage and cargo (my daughter attends UCI) and even helped me load into the car. Very helpful answering questions and even gave me a fuel discount without my asking. Flight planning area was great and my wife really enjoyed the well furnished pilots' lounge while I was flight planning. I fly a single engine Cessna (177RG) and was just in for the day. No charges except for fuel, which wasn't outrageous.
 
From John Wilson on 09-Sep-2009
Worst FBO! Line and desk staff rude and unhelpful. Couldn't be bothered to assist w/ parking and front desk was too busy studying her LVN book to offer water, directions or anything. Rental car way overpriced ($70 Corolla!) and it had 2 mx lights on. Desk person didn’t offer alternate car. When returned, they didn't know where they towed my Mooney and it wasn’t fueled. Previous post said $5 for parking, but it must have gone up, it was $20. They claimed that was county fee, and said they waived their ramp fee for fuel order. Atlantic must not want small planes, only jets.
 
From Christopher Lumsdaine on 13-Aug-2009
Flew into SNA on an Angel Flight mission. They were kind enough to park both aircraft up front to pick up / drop off our passengers. They helped the passengers with their luggage and waived the ramp fee for Angel Flight (unlike the other FBO on the field who said it would be "business as usual" for the fee.) This FBO deserves you business.
 
From Brian Carr on 09-Jul-2009
The service at Atlantic was outstanding. Helpful, cheerful staff. Only charged $5 nightly ramp fee with fuel purchase. Even with all of the Jets, treated a GA pilot like a VIP.
